Carolyne-Craig Schwenke, the daughter of Allen Craig and Te Ani Kimioranga Cribb Craig, (Ngati Raukawa, Maniapoto and Tainui Iwi) was born in New Zealand but lived in Samoa for a number of years as a student at Church College of Western Samoa (CCWS) and later as a flight attendant for Polynesian Airlines in the late 1970s. Her Craig family in Samoa are prominent business owners. Carolyne owned a number of family businesses in New Zealand, China and now Australia.

Reg Schwenke was also born and raised in New Zealand, but lived in Samoa for a number of years. He attended CCWS for one year before becoming a reporter and later chief reporter for The Samoa Times in the early 1970s – when it was Samoa’s largest newspaper. He went on to become the first Samoan reporter at The Auckland Star, The Honolulu Advertiser and Pacific Business News in Honolulu (where he placed second in a national USA journalism competition for Investigative Reporting) and Editor/Publisher for TotalBlueSports.com. He was also Senior Vice President at the Polynesian Cultural Center in Hawaii for five years. 

Both Reg and Carolyne are also co-founders of the annual Aloha World Sevens Rugby tournament in Honolulu. Mahonri Schwalger’s Rugby Academy Samoa represented the country this year, placing second to a New Zealand team coached/owned by current All Black Liam Messam.

Based in Queensland, Rukutai has a distinguished China backstory. The married co-founders lived and operated their product sourcing, immigration and education services business from China for years before relocating to Australia in 2014. 

In 2007, Rukutai was granted a coveted 20-year Wholly Foreign Owned Enterprise (WFOE) China business licence to conduct business in seven different sectors of commerce – International business, Education, Immigration, Travel, Technology, Financial Investments and Environmental Management.
